Piper PA-15 N4549H
27 August 1989 · Independence, Oregon, United States · No injuries
Summary
On 27 August 1989 at about 17:53 local time, a Piper PA-15 registered N4549H was involved in an accident near Independence, Oregon, United States. 2 people were on board and nobody was injured. The aircraft was substantially damaged. The NTSB has published a probable cause for this accident; it is quoted in full below.

Probable cause
FAILURE OF THE PILOT TO MAINTAIN DIRECTIONAL CONTROL DURING THE LANDING, WHICH RESULTED IN AN INADVERTENT GROUND LOOP AND SUBSEQUENT OVERLOAD FAILURE OF THE LEFT MAIN GEAR. A FACTOR RELATED TO THE ACCIDENT WAS: IMPROPER FLARE BY THE PILOT.
Quoted verbatim from the NTSB record. This site does not paraphrase or interpret it.
Read the full NTSB narrative
DURING THE LANDING, THE ACFT TOUCHED DOWN WITH SLOW AIRSPEED (RPRTDLY TAILWHEEL 1ST), THEN GROUND LOOPED TO THE RIGHT. SUBSEQUENTLY, THE LEFT MAIN GEAR COLLAPSED, THE RIGHT WING WAS DAMAGED AND THE PROP STRUCK THE GROUND. NO PREVIOUS MECHANICAL PROBLEMS WERE REPORTED.
